一种智能选矿机的主控系统技术方案

技术编号:39409815 阅读:18 留言:0更新日期:2023-11-19 16:01
本发明专利技术公开了一种智能选矿机的主控系统,属于智能选矿机电气控制技术领域。本发明专利技术采用STM32单片机作为控制芯片,并设计了AD转化和外部中断采集模块、信号触发模块、网络和485通信模块、信号输入模块及信号输出模块。控制芯片与核心模块构成最小系统,信号输入模块和信号输出模块可实现多颗芯片串级使用,实现了智能选矿机的设备信息采集及控制信号输出的可靠性和可扩展性。相较于现有技术,本发明专利技术具有全面采集设备信息、可靠输出控制信号、简化系统配置和维护便利的优势,从而使智能选矿机的稳定运行和高效性得到提升,满足不断变化的选矿需求。本发明专利技术为选矿过程带来明显改进,推动了选矿行业向智能化方向发展。了选矿行业向智能化方向发展。了选矿行业向智能化方向发展。

【技术实现步骤摘要】
一种智能选矿机的主控系统


[0001]本专利技术属于智能选矿机电气控制
,涉及一种智能选矿机电气控制系统。

技术介绍

[0002]智能选矿机在选矿过程中通过主控系统采集设备各部件的信息,并上传至上位机。上位机判断设备各部件是否正常,并向主控系统发送控制指令,实现选矿机的正常运行。主控系统充当上位机与选矿机之间的信息交互中心,负责采集设备关键信息和输出控制信号。
[0003]然而,现有的智能选矿机技术存在以下缺陷:设备关键信息采集不全面,现有系统可能未能充分采集选矿机各部件的相关信息,导致在故障预警和设备状态监测方面存在不足;控制信号的可靠性不高,上位机发送的控制指令可能由于通信问题或其他原因,导致未能及时、准确地控制选矿机的运行,影响选矿过程的效率和稳定性;设备功能扩展受限,现有系统在功能扩展方面存在困难,难以满足不断变化的选矿需求和技术发展。

技术实现思路

[0004]本专利技术的目的在于提供一种智能选矿机的主控系统,为设备信息采集及控制信号输出提供可靠可扩展的电气控制系统,以解决上述
技术介绍
中提出的问题。
[0005]为了解决上述技术问题,本专利技术提供如下技术方案:
[0006]根据本专利技术的第一方面,所述一种智能选矿机的主控系统采用STM32单片机做为控制芯片,设计AD转化和外部中断采集模块、信号触发模块、网络和485通信模块、信号输入模块及信号输出模块。其中控制芯片与AD转化和外部中断采集模块、信号触发模块、网络和485通信模块设计成最小系统,信号输入模块及信号输出模块分别设计成可扩展模块,当输入输出端口紧张时,串接扩展。
[0007]所述STM32单片机,是一种由STMicroelectronics公司开发的32位微控制器单片机,它采用ARM Cortex

M内核,具有高性能、低功耗、丰富的外设和强大的计算能力;STM32单片机包括CPU核心、存储器、定时器、通信接口、模拟输入输出(ADC、DAC)、GPIO的外设功能,这些外设功能使得STM32单片机可以处理多种任务,从简单的数据采集到复杂的控制算法。
[0008]所述AD转化和外部中断采集模块,该模块是系统中的一个部件组合;所述AD转化模块是指模拟

数字转换模块,在智能选矿机的主控系统中,AD转化模块是一种重要的硬件部件,用于将选矿机各部件产生的模拟信号转换为数字信号,以便数字系统进行处理和分析;选矿机的各个部件通常会产生模拟信号,包括电机电流、温度传感器输出、振动传感器信号;这些模拟信号是连续变化的,无法直接用于数字系统进行处理,因此,需要将这些模拟信号转换为数字信号,以便数字系统可以对其进行采样、存储、处理和分析;AD转化模块通常由一个或多个模拟

数字转换器组成,每个转换器可以处理一个模拟信号通道;当模拟信号进入AD转化模块时,转换器会对信号进行采样和量化,将连续的模拟信号转换为离散
的数字值;转换后的数字信号由所述STM32单片机进行处理,进行算法运算、实时监测和故障检测;AD转化模块在智能选矿机中的应用非常广泛,它实现对选矿机各部件产生的模拟信号的准确采集和转换,从而实现对设备状态和运行情况的监测和控制;通过AD转化模块,主控系统可以获得准确的设备信息,为智能选矿机的稳定运行和高效性提供重要支持;所述外部中断采集模块,用于实现外部事件的触发和采集。在所述智能选矿机的运行过程中,会发生一些外部事件或信号的变化,包括传感器检测到异常、按键触发和通信接口接收到指令,这些事件需要被及时感知和处理;外部中断采集模块由硬件中断触发器和中断检测电路组成,当外部事件发生时,触发器会产生中断信号,向所述STM32单片机发出中断请求;所述STM32单片机接收到中断请求后,会立即暂停当前的运行任务,跳转到中断服务程序,执行相应的中断处理操作;在所述智能选矿机中,外部中断采集模块将与所述AD转化模块配合工作,实现对设备各部件信息的全面采集和控制信号的输出;这样,选矿机的主控系统能够根据实时的外部事件和设备状态,灵活地调整运行策略,提高选矿机的运行效率和智能化水平。
[0009]所述信号触发模块采用异或门逻辑比对输出的触发信号及返回的触发信号,实现快速判断触发信号是否输送到传感器及喷阀控制模块,是本专利技术中的一个重要硬件部件,其主要功能是根据设定的条件和规则触发相应的控制信号输出;在智能选矿机的运行过程中,根据不同的情况和需求,需要对选矿机的运行状态进行自动调整和优化,以实现更高效的选矿过程;信号触发模块包含一个逻辑控制单元和相关的输入接口,逻辑控制单元会根据预先设定的触发条件,对接收到的输入信号进行处理和判断;一旦触发条件满足,逻辑控制单元会产生相应的控制信号,将其发送到选矿机的执行部件,实现对选矿机的控制;触发条件可以是多种多样的,可以基于选矿机自身的状态、运行参数,也可以基于外部输入信号(传感器数据、用户操作指令);当选矿机的产物质量不达标时,信号触发模块可以触发相应的控制信号,调整选矿机的参数,以提高分选效果;当传感器检测到异常情况时,信号触发模块可以触发报警信号,提示运维人员进行处理;所述信号触发模块在智能选矿机中发挥着关键作用,它能够实现选矿机的自动控制和优化,提高选矿机的生产效率和品质;通过合理设定触发条件和灵活配置触发规则,信号触发模块能够适应不同的选矿需求,使选矿机的运行更加智能化和自动化。
[0010]所述网络和485通信模块,用于实现选矿机与上位机或其他设备之间的数据交互和通信;在现代工业自动化和智能控制系统中,通信模块扮演着连接不同设备和系统的桥梁角色,实现数据传输和控制命令的传递;所述网络通信模块,允许选矿机通过网络与上位机或其他智能设备进行通信;通过网络通信,选矿机可以将设备信息、运行状态和控制信号的数据传输到上位机,实现远程监控和控制;同时,上位机也可以向选矿机发送控制指令,实现远程调节和优化选矿机的运行。所述485通信模块,是一种串行通信模块,采用RS

485通信协议。485通信模块常用于工业现场控制和设备间的短距离通信;在智能选矿机中,485通信模块可以与其他设备或传感器进行数据交互,接收传感器数据、接收外部控制信号;网络和485通信模块的主要作用是实现选矿机与其他设备之间的高效数据传输和控制命令的传递,通过这些通信模块,智能选矿机可以与上位机、监控系统、其他智能设备进行互联互通,实现数据共享和资源协调,提高选矿机的智能化和自动化水平;同时,网络和485通信模块也为选矿机的远程监控和维护提供了便利。
[0011]所述信号输入模块采用8位并行读取、串行输入移位寄存器74HC165,并可实现多颗芯片串级使用。单个模块采用4颗74HC165芯片级联,实现32路输入信号,当32路输入信号不够时,可实现多个模块级联,实现多路输入信号的扩展。主要功能是接收外部信号或命令,用于向所述STM32单片机反馈选矿机的实时状态和接收控制指令;在智能选矿机的运行过程中,会涉及到各种外部输入信号,例如来自传感器的检测数据、操作员的控制指令本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种智能选矿机的主控系统,其特征在于:该系统包括STM32单片机作为控制芯片,并设置AD转化和外部中断采集模块、信号触发模块、网络和485通信模块、信号输入模块和信号输出模块;所述AD转化和外部中断采集模块,负责将模拟信号转换成数字信号,其中外部中断采集模块用于检测和响应特定事件;所述信号触发模块用于根据选矿机的工作状态和设备信息的变化,生成相应的触发信号,触发信号用于激活其他模块和调整选矿机的工作参数;所述信号触发模块将使用机器学习触发算法,将会根据历史数据和模式来预测和判断是否需要触发特定操作;所述网络和485通信模块,网络模块允许主控系统与上位机或其他设备进行数据交互,将设备信息上传至上位机或接收远程控制指令,485通信模块与选矿机内部和外部的其他设备进行数据传输和通信;所述信号输入模块,该模块用于接收外部输入信号,以反馈给主控系统进行处理和分析;所述信号输出模块,信号输出模块用于向外部设备和执行部件发送控制信号,调整选矿机的工作状态和参数;控制芯片与AD转化和外部中断采集模块、信号触发模块、网络和485通信模块被设计成最小系统,所述最小系统构成了主控系统的核心功能,负责设备信息采集和通信交互关键任务;而信号输入模块和信号输出模块被设计成可扩展模块,以应对输入输出端口不足时的需求。2.根据权利要求1所述一种智能选矿机的主控系统,其特征在于:所述特定事件,包括当智能选矿机的某个部件发生故障和异常时,所述外部中断采集模块能够检测到这种状态并触发相应的响应操作;当选矿机的运行状态发生变化,所述外部中断采集模块能够检测到这种状态转换,并根据需要进行相应的操作;当选矿机的进料和产出量发生变化时,所述外部中断采集模块将会检测到这种变化,并根据预设条件执行相应的控制动作;所述外部中断采集模块将会监测智能选矿机周围的环境条件,以便对选矿机的运行做出适当的调整。3.根据权利要求1所述一种智能选矿机的主控系统,其特征在于:所述机器学习触发算法,将使用基于阈值的二元分类模型中的逻辑回归算法,用于预测一个样本属于两个类别中的哪一个;在所述信号触发模块中,根据历史数据和特征,将会训练一个逻辑回归模型来预测是否需要触发特定操作;当应用训练好的逻辑回归模型时,所述模型会输出一个概率值,表示样本属于某个类别的概率,所述模型将一个类别定义为需要触发特定操作,另一个类别定义为不需要触发特定操作;通过逻辑回归模型的输出概率值,能够判断样本属于需要触发特定操作的类别的概率有多大,从而决定是否进行触发;当逻辑回归模型输出的概率值在0.9到1之间,表示模型确信样本属于某个类别;当逻辑回归模型输出的概率值在0到0.1之间,表示模型确信样本不属于某个类别;所述特定操作包括:发出报警,触发停机,调整设备的运行状态和参数,调整设备的能源使用策略,调整设备的生产计划和流程,制定维护计划,调整数据采集的频率和方式,切换运行模式;逻辑回归的数学公式如下:
其中,h
θ
(x)是逻辑回归模型的预测输出,表示触发所述特定操作的概率;θ是逻辑回归模型的参数向量,通过训练数据进行学习得到;x是输入特征向量,包括选矿机各个部件的实时状态信息;T表示指数函数的底数,取自然对数的底数e;e表示自然对数的底数;根据上述公式,模型会计算输入特征向量x对应的预测概率值,表示触发所述特定操作的可能性;当预测概率值超过预设的阈值时,信号触发模块会触发相应的所述特定操作。4.根据权利要求3所述一种智能选矿机的主控系统,其特征在于:所述实时状态信息,包括智能选矿机各个部件的温度,设备的振动频率,各个部件的电流使用情况,系统内部的压力大小,智能选矿机内部液体和气体的流量情况,设备的位置信息,设备的运行速度,各个部件的电压情况,设备出现的故障码,智能选矿机内部液体的液位高度,设备周围环境的湿度,每次数据采集的时间戳;所述各个部件,包括发动机、电机、传感器、控制器、输送带、振动筛、水泵、润滑系统、电气控制柜、规律器、传动系统、齿轮箱、筛板、输送管道和控制面板。5.根据权利要求1所述一种智能选矿机的主控系统的智能管理控制方法,其特征在于:该方法包括以下步骤:S5

1、通过移动设备连...

【专利技术属性】
技术研发人员:何鹏宇杨威张宏亮熊劲王凡
申请(专利权)人:赣州好朋友科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1